1use std::io;
2use std::path::Path;
3
4use crate::Image;
5
6use super::{Axes, Canvas, LineStyle, MarkerStyle};
7
8pub const DEFAULT_SIZE: (usize, usize) = (640, 480);
10
11pub struct Plot {
13 width: usize,
14 height: usize,
15 scale: usize,
16 inset_x: usize,
17 inset_y: usize,
18 axes: Axes,
19 series: Vec<PlotSeries>,
20}
21
22enum PlotSeries {
23 Line(Vec<(f64, f64)>, LineStyle),
24 Markers(Vec<(f64, f64)>, MarkerStyle),
25}
26
27impl Plot {
28 pub fn new() -> Self {
30 Self {
31 width: DEFAULT_SIZE.0,
32 height: DEFAULT_SIZE.1,
33 scale: 1,
34 inset_x: DEFAULT_SIZE.0 / 10,
35 inset_y: DEFAULT_SIZE.1 / 10,
36 axes: Axes::new(),
37 series: Vec::new(),
38 }
39 }
40
41 pub fn size(mut self, width: usize, height: usize) -> Self {
43 let x_ratio = self.inset_x as f64 / self.width.max(1) as f64;
44 let y_ratio = self.inset_y as f64 / self.height.max(1) as f64;
45 self.width = width;
46 self.height = height;
47 self.inset_x = (width as f64 * x_ratio).round() as usize;
48 self.inset_y = (height as f64 * y_ratio).round() as usize;
49 self
50 }
51
52 pub fn scale(mut self, factor: usize) -> Self {
54 assert!(factor > 0, "plot scale must be greater than zero");
55 self.scale = factor;
56 self
57 }
58
59 pub fn margins(mut self, horizontal: usize, vertical: usize) -> Self {
61 self.inset_x = horizontal;
62 self.inset_y = vertical;
63 self
64 }
65
66 pub fn axes(mut self, axes: Axes) -> Self {
68 self.axes = axes;
69 self
70 }
71
72 pub fn line(mut self, points: &[(f64, f64)], style: LineStyle) -> Self {
74 self.series.push(PlotSeries::Line(points.to_vec(), style));
75 self
76 }
77
78 pub fn markers(mut self, points: &[(f64, f64)], style: MarkerStyle) -> Self {
80 self.series
81 .push(PlotSeries::Markers(points.to_vec(), style));
82 self
83 }
84
85 pub fn render(self) -> Image {
87 let scale = self.scale;
88 let mut canvas = Canvas::with_inset(
89 self.width.saturating_mul(scale),
90 self.height.saturating_mul(scale),
91 self.axes,
92 self.inset_x.saturating_mul(scale),
93 self.inset_y.saturating_mul(scale),
94 );
95 canvas.set_render_scale(scale);
96 canvas.render();
97 for series in self.series {
98 match series {
99 PlotSeries::Line(points, mut style) => {
100 style.width = style.width.saturating_mul(scale);
101 canvas.line(&points, style);
102 }
103 PlotSeries::Markers(points, mut style) => {
104 style.size = style.size.saturating_mul(scale);
105 canvas.markers(&points, style);
106 }
107 }
108 }
109 canvas.into_image()
110 }
111
112 pub fn save(self, path: impl AsRef<Path>) -> io::Result<()> {
114 self.render().save(path)
115 }
116}
117
118impl Default for Plot {
119 fn default() -> Self {
120 Self::new()
121 }
122}
123
124#[cfg(test)]
125mod tests {
126 use super::*;
127 use crate::Pixel;
128
129 #[test]
130 fn builder_renders_multiple_styled_series() {
131 let image = Plot::new()
132 .size(11, 11)
133 .margins(0, 0)
134 .axes(Axes::from_limits((0.0, 1.0), (0.0, 1.0)))
135 .line(
136 &[(0.0, 0.0), (1.0, 1.0)],
137 LineStyle::new().color(Pixel::rgb(0, 128, 0)),
138 )
139 .markers(
140 &[(0.0, 1.0)],
141 MarkerStyle::new().color(Pixel::rgb(255, 128, 0)),
142 )
143 .render();
144
145 assert_eq!(image.get_pixel(5, 5), Some(&Pixel::rgb(0, 128, 0)));
146 assert_eq!(image.get_pixel(0, 0), Some(&Pixel::rgb(255, 128, 0)));
147 }
148
149 #[test]
150 fn scale_increases_output_resolution() {
151 let image = Plot::new().size(100, 80).scale(2).render();
152 assert_eq!((image.width, image.height), (200, 160));
153 }
